AMANULLAH v. COBB

Civ. A. No. 87-1195-T.

673 F.Supp. 28 (1987)

AMANULLAH and Wahidullah, Petitioners, v. Charles T. COBB, as District Director of the Boston District of the Immigration and Naturalization Service, Respondent.

United States District Court, D. Massachusetts.

May 28, 1987.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Arthur Helton, Lawyers Committee for Human Rights, New York City, Regina Lee, Legal Services Center, Jamaica Plain, Mass., for petitioners.

Evan Slavitt, Asst. U.S. Atty., Boston, Mass., for respondent.


MEMORANDUM

TAURO, District Judge.

This is a Petition for Writ of Habeas Corpus brought by two Afghan nationals who unsuccessfully applied for political asylum in the United States1, and who now face exclusion and deportation2 to India under the provisions of 8 U.S.C. §§ 1225 and 1226.
